Wittenberge - Guide for Tourists and Visitors
Nestled in the picturesque Brandenburg region of Germany, Wittenberge is a charming city that boasts a rich history and a vibrant community. Established in the early 13th century, Wittenberge has evolved from a small settlement into a thriving urban center. With a population of approximately 18,000 residents, this city offers a unique blend of historical significance and modern amenities, making it an attractive destination for tourists and visitors alike.
Wittenberge is situated along the banks of the Elbe River, providing stunning views and a serene atmosphere. The city is known for its well-preserved architecture, including beautiful brick buildings that reflect its historical roots. Best Time to Visit Wittenberge
When planning your vacation to Wittenberge, it's essential to consider the best time to visit. The city experiences a temperate climate, characterized by warm summers and cold winters. The average temperature throughout the year ranges from a chilly 0°C in winter to a pleasant 25°C in summer. Spring and autumn are particularly lovely, with mild temperatures and beautiful foliage, making these seasons ideal for outdoor activities and sightseeing.
Visitors should also keep in mind that summer is the peak tourist season, attracting many travelers eager to enjoy the warm weather and vibrant local events. However, if you prefer a quieter experience, consider visiting during the shoulder seasons of spring or autumn, when the crowds are thinner, and the natural beauty of Wittenberge is at its finest.

Top Sights of the City
Wittenberge is home to several remarkable sights that showcase its historical and cultural significance. Here are five top places to visit during your stay:
- St. Stephen's Church: This stunning Gothic-style church is a must-see, featuring intricate architecture and beautiful stained glass windows that tell the story of the city's past.
- The Old Town: Wander through the charming streets of Wittenberge's Old Town, where you can admire well-preserved buildings and quaint shops that reflect the city's history.
- Elbe Bridge: An iconic landmark, the Elbe Bridge offers breathtaking views of the river and surrounding landscape, making it a perfect spot for photography enthusiasts.
- Wittenberge Water Tower: This historic water tower, built in the late 19th century, is a symbol of the city and provides a unique perspective on Wittenberge's development over the years.
- The Local Market Square: Experience the vibrant atmosphere of the market square, where you can find fresh produce, local crafts, and seasonal events that highlight the community's spirit.
